Choosing the Right Containers


When it comes to organizing your spice jars, selecting the right containers is crucial for both functionality and aesthetics. Glass jars are a popular choice as they allow you to easily see the contents and add a touch of elegance to your kitchen. They come in various sizes, ensuring that you can find the perfect fit for your spice collection, whether you have a few essential items or an extensive array of seasonings.


Plastic containers are another option worth considering. They are lightweight and often come with airtight seals that help preserve the freshness of your spices. While some may worry about the potential for chemical leaching, many modern plastic containers are BPA-free, making them a safe choice for your kitchen. Choose clear plastic to maintain visibility while protecting your spices from light exposure.


For a more rustic approach, consider using metal tins or wooden boxes. These materials not only provide a unique look to your spice organization but also offer durability. Metal tins can be magnetized, allowing you to attach them to your fridge, saving counter space. Wooden boxes, on the other hand, can be a charming addition to your countertop, especially if you enjoy a more natural aesthetic in your kitchen.


Labeling Your Spices


Labeling is a crucial step in organizing your spice jars effectively. Clear and consistent labels help you quickly identify what you need while cooking, saving you time and frustration. You can opt for traditional labels or get creative with designs that match your kitchen aesthetic. Choose a labeling method that works for you, whether it’s handwritten, printed, or using a label maker.


When labeling your spices, consider including not just the name of the spice but also the date of purchase. This information can help you keep track of freshness and ensure that you’re using your spices at their peak flavor. Additionally, incorporating icons or color coding can make it easier to quickly recognize your favorite seasonings and blends at a glance.


Lastly, think about the placement of your labels. For jar lids, side labels, or front-facing tags, each option has its merits. Ensure that labels are easily readable and positioned for maximum visibility. A well-labeled spice collection not only enhances your cooking experience but also adds an organized and polished look to your kitchen.
